United States Vs. Hon. Jose C. Abreu, Et Al. 030 Phil 402

THE UNITED STATES, petitioner, vs. THE HONORABLE JOSE C. ABREU, PONCIANO REMIGIO, JOSE LEON, JOSE GOMEZ ARCE, ANTONIO DIZON, and LUCAS GUEVARA, respondents.

G.R. No. 10252 | 1915-03-26

D E C I S I O N


PER CURIAM, :

This is an application for the writ of mandamus. Its purpose is to order and to require the respondent judge to continue with the disposition and to decide a case which had been theretofore tried by another judge. The facts upon which the petition is based are as follows:

First. That on the 6th day of December, 1913, the auxiliary fiscal of the city of Manila presented a complaint charging the respondents, Ponciano Remigio, Jose Leon, Jose Gomez Arce, Antonio Dizon, and Lucas Guevara, with the crime of estafa.

Second. That upon the complaint the said respondents were duly arrested, arraigned, and placed...
